DOTHAN:   8:59 PM  Dothan 911 dispatched a structure fire in the 200 block of Campbellton Highway, ACROSS from Hunt’s Restaurant. Dothan 911 reported smoke and flames visible. Multiple Dothan Fire Engine Companies, Pilcher Ambulance and Dothan Police dispatched.

THIS IS NOT HUNT’S – THIS IS NOT HUNT’S

9:02 PM   Dothan Fire Engine 2 ( Lakewood ) arrived on the scene followed by Dothan Fire Egine 1 ( Central ). Reported an abandoned house where homeless people stayed, smoke and flames visible. A working structure fire.

9:05 PM    Dothan Fire Engine 10 ( West Main Street ), Dothan Fire Truck 1 ( Central ) arrived on the scene.

9:06 PM   Dothan Fire Battalion Chief 2, Braswell,  arrived on the scene.

9:08 PM    Fire on all sides, partial roof collapse. Dothan Fire Battalion Chief announced defensive fire. Fireamn are hampered on back side search due to brush on the back side.

9:09 PM    Dothan Fire Rehab truck has arrived on the scene. Dothan Fire Truck 1 reports fully involved.

9:10 PM    Fire hydrant water established 3 minutes ago.

NOTE:  8:41 PM Dothan Fire Engine Company 4 ( Southside ) was on a medical emergency when call dispatched.  

9:11 PM    The Safety Officer reports need a collapse zone. Walls are beginning to sway. Floor is collapsing. Tape is being set up for collapse zone. Dothan Fire Battalion Chief Braswell makes sure everyone on the scene is aware to maintain a collapse zone. The front has already collapsed.
